I have a sneaking suspicion most of Q2 is going to be boring AF, with mostly sideways action. ...
I expect the same, because there are too many parties that are incentivized to keep Bitcoin above the average cost of mining a single Bitcoin. Therefore the downside risk from the current price level is minimal. Of course it is possible that some miners try to bankrupt their competitors by driving the price lower and mining at a loss for a while, but if a situation like that would occur it would only be temporary anyway. The upside potential is probably limited too for now after the parabolic rise at the end of 2017. Other developments like the decay of the major altcoins and the upcoming block reward halving in 2020 will drive the BTC price to new highs again. I personally intend to withdraw all my personal investments that are not in Bitcoin right now during 2018 and commit 100 % of my investment portfolio to Bitcoin going forward. Therefore I would actually be pretty content if the price would remain below 10k $ for a few more months until I get that sorted out.
